Lucid Group Inc

Lucid Group (LCID) trades at $6.61, down 6.11% amid ongoing operational challenges. The stock shows bearish technical signals with negative moving averages and faces fundamental headwinds including consistent quarterly losses, negative profit margins, and substantial cash burn. Recent news highlights an operational reset targeting $1.4 billion in cash improvements and delays to the affordable Cosmos EV launch to 2027.

The outlook remains challenging with deep losses and cash burn overshadowing revenue growth. Analyst consensus is cautious with 67% hold ratings, though the $10.50 price target suggests potential upside. Key risks include execution of turnaround plans, intense EV competition, and funding needs. The stock's direction hinges on successful cost reductions and future product execution.

About iShares Core High Dividend ETF

The fund generally will invest at least 80% of its assets in the component securities of its underlying index and in investments that have economic characteristics that are substantially identical to the component securities of its underlying index. The underlying index is comprised of qualified income paying securities that are screened for superior company quality and financial health as determined by Morningstar, Inc.'s proprietary index methodology. The fund is non-diversified.

About Lucid Group Inc

Lucid Group Inc is a technology and automotive company. It develops the next generation of electric vehicle (EV) technologies. It is a vertically integrated company that designs, engineers, and builds electric vehicles, EV powertrains, and battery systems in-house using our own equipment and factory.
